const hmac = (key: string, message: string, encoding: any) => {
  return crypto
    .createHmac('sha256', key)
    .update(message, 'utf8')
    .digest(encoding);
};

export const makeCredential = () => {
  const credential =
    AWS_ACCESS_KEY_ID +
    '/' +
    format(new Date(), 'YYYYMMDD') +
    '/' +
    AWS_REGION +
    '/s3/aws4_request';
  return credential;
};

export const makePolicy = (
  credential: string,
  longDate: string,
  acl: string
) => {
  const tomorrow = addHours(new Date(), 24);
  const policy = {
    conditions: [
      { bucket: process.env.AWS_S3_UPLOAD_BUCKET_NAME },
      ['starts-with', '$key', ''],
      { acl },
      ['content-length-range', 0, +process.env.AWS_S3_UPLOAD_MAX_SIZE],
      ['starts-with', '$Content-Type', 'image'],
      ['starts-with', '$Cache-Control', ''],
      { 'x-amz-algorithm': 'AWS4-HMAC-SHA256' },
      { 'x-amz-credential': credential },
      { 'x-amz-date': longDate },
    ],
    expiration: format(tomorrow, 'YYYY-MM-DDTHH:mm:ss\\Z'),
  };

  return new Buffer(JSON.stringify(policy)).toString('base64');
};

export const getSignature = (policy: any) => {
  const kDate = hmac(
    'AWS4' + AWS_SECRET_ACCESS_KEY,
    format(new Date(), 'YYYYMMDD')
  );
  const kRegion = hmac(kDate, AWS_REGION);
  const kService = hmac(kRegion, 's3');
  const kCredentials = hmac(kService, 'aws4_request');

  const signature = hmac(kCredentials, policy, 'hex');
  return signature;
};
